The biggest tracked US breakfast restaurants chains by card spend, with year-over-year growth of category share. Share means a chain's slice of tracked category spend. It can decline while the chain's own sales grow. The chart tracks IHOP's share of the category quarter by quarter, indexed to 2024 Q1 = 100.

Store footprint
Store map
1,433 tracked IHOP locations across 49 US states and DC.
